在WinBox中将动态ARP设置为静态的ARP记录。[admin@MikroTik] ip arp> add address=192.168.1.248 interface=ether1-lan mac-address=00:21:00:56:00:12
设置ether1-lan interface 仅回应静态 ARP的请求,
脚本操作如下:arp=reply-only[admin@RB230] > interface ethernet set ether2 arp=reply-only
ARP 双向绑定事例:
首先将所有/ip arp列表中的所有LAN口的 ARP信息变为静态的,我们可以通过脚本做批处理的修改。注意,可能通过脚本命令不一定能将所有的内网的ARP参数修改完,可能需要手动添加。
:foreach i in [/ip arp find dynamic=yes interface=LAN] do={
/ip arp add copy-from=$i}
设置 LAN 的网卡为:disabled
如果 ARP 功能在接口上被关闭,例如:使用 arp=disabled,来至客户端的 ARP 请求将不被路由器回应,因此
必须添加静态的 ARP 才行。 例如,通过 arp 命令将路由器的 IP和 MAC 地址必须添加到 windows工作站中:
[admin@MikroTik] ip arp> /interface ethernet set LAN arp=disabled
现在路由器已经绑定了内网主机的所有 IP 地址后,现在需要对 Windows 电脑做对路由器绑定的设置
C:\> arp -s 10.5.8.254 00-aa-00-62-c6-09
也可以编辑windows 自己的批处理文件(.dat)操作
winbox登录 IP-》arp 然后在IP地址上点右键-》Make Static。搞定,当然也可以写个脚本自动绑定IP地址。
[admin@MikroTik] >
[admin@MikroTik] > /ip arp
[admin@MikroTik] /ip arp> :foreach i in=[find dynamic=yes] do={add copy-from=$i}[admin@MikroTik] /ip arp>
http://www.awolf.net